christopher johnson wrote:i want to post some pictures . but i dont know how?
The easiest way I have found to post them is if you have a Picasa account or a facebook or other image hosting available to you as shown in this post up top..
Go to said image host.. open the picture you would like to post. right click the picture select COPY IMAGE URL then when you go to post it in here insert this [img][/img] Paste the image url between the ][ and then your picture should show up like this
